Dorothy E. Denning is the Patricia and Patrick Callahan Family Professor of Computer Science and Director of the Georgetown Institute for Information Assurance at Georgetown University. She is also affiliated with the Communication, Culture, and Technology program, the Science and Technology in International Affairs program, and the Center for Peace and Security Studies. Her research is primarily related to information warfare and security.
